What is PNO?
Principal Nodal Officer (PNO) is a senior official appointed by banks and financial institutions in India to handle customer complaints that remain unresolved at the branch level. Under the Reserve Bank of India's Banking Ombudsman Scheme, the PNO acts as the key point of contact for escalated grievances, ensuring timely redressal and coordination with the Banking Ombudsman. This role is critical in maintaining transparency and accountability in the banking sector, as customers can approach the PNO before moving to the Ombudsman. The term is widely used in banking operations, complaint management portals, and regulatory communications. For competitive exams like IBPS, SBI PO, and RBI Grade B, understanding the PNO's functions is essential for the banking awareness section. The PNO's office is often the last internal step before external dispute resolution, making it a cornerstone of customer service in Indian banking.

Example
If the branch manager fails to resolve your issue within 30 days, you can escalate the complaint to the Principal Nodal Officer (PNO) of the bank through their official grievance portal.
